Start with OpenAI's narrow definition

OpenAI's phrase 'research intern' does not describe an autonomous scientist choosing its own research agenda. The company defines it as a system that can carry out well-defined research tasks under human direction, including work that would take a skilled researcher a few days. People still select priorities, decide which ideas deserve more resources and determine whether systems should be scaled, paused or deployed.

That distinction is the center of the story. A tool can produce a large amount of useful work without owning the scientific judgment around it. OpenAI says its longer-term target is an automated AI researcher by March 2028, but the new post does not claim that broader goal has been reached.

More agent time does not equal the same amount of progress

By mid-August, OpenAI's research organization was using 3.1 agent-workdays for every workday of human labor, counting a standard eight-hour day. Researchers increasingly run several agents at once, write more code and conduct more experiments. The company also reports that experiment volume per active experimenter reached a high in August in data tracked since January 2025.

OpenAI explicitly warns against turning those activity measures into a simple multiplier for discovery. More code can contain more debugging work, and more experiments can be enabled by additional compute as well as better agents. Research advances only when design, data, infrastructure, evaluation, safety work and interpretation succeed together. The slowest of those steps becomes the new bottleneck.

The intervention rate is the most useful reality check

For successful tasks estimated to require four to eight hours of human work, more than half involved at least one human intervention during the six months analyzed. OpenAI says agent success has improved across several difficulty buckets, but steering remains especially important as tasks become more complex. High-level planning still represents a minimal share of agent output tokens.

This does not make the agents unimportant. It tells us where their value currently sits: coding, infrastructure work, troubleshooting, experiments and technical assistance under supervision. A team evaluating similar tools should measure completed, reviewed outcomes and the time humans spend correcting or redirecting them — not prompts sent, tokens consumed or hours the agent remained active.

A security incident changed the pace of work

OpenAI says it temporarily shut down a training container service on July 20 after agents compromised research infrastructure. It then restored the environment with additional restrictions and paused reinforcement learning on its latest deployable models for about two weeks while hardening and red-teaming the system. Later evidence of possible critical cyber capability led to additional restrictions for Astra-class work.

Those details matter because automated research expands both throughput and operational risk. The report says compute shifted toward other model classes when Astra work was constrained, illustrating that a safety pause in one area does not automatically stop the wider research machine. Controls need to cover infrastructure, permissions, monitoring and allocation decisions, not only model behavior in a demonstration.

Our take: this is an operations report, not proof of recursive self-improvement

The most responsible reading is neither dismissal nor a science-fiction leap. OpenAI provides evidence that coding agents have become a substantial part of its daily research operation. It also provides evidence that human judgment, intervention and compute remain central, and admits that its metrics are still difficult to interpret.

The next reports should make comparisons easier: stable definitions, outcome-based measures, failed-task rates, intervention time and external scrutiny where security allows. Until then, 'AI research intern' is a useful description of task scope, not proof that a model independently runs the laboratory or that research speed will compound without limit.

Sources & Methods

Checked September 7, 2026 against OpenAI's September 6 research report. All usage, intervention and incident figures are self-reported by OpenAI and described by the company as preliminary. Lumacta did not access the internal systems or reproduce the measurements.
